One idea is to make a virtual copy before you use the reflection. In this case you have "saved" the originally editings that you have made. Another alternative is to make a snapshot. In this case you can go back to this point on every time.

@AxelMatt reply is a great solution. to add to that there is a plug in called Any Filter plugin that will show you this info. Lightroom does not consider cropping or flipping and image a change to the image but only of its display.
